Beaver Valley Power Station, Unit No. 1 Docket No. 50-334, License No. DPR-66 IE Inspection Report No. 81-03 Gentlemen:
Our reply to the Notice of Violation for Inspection No. 81-03 was submit.ted on August 3, 1981.
Mr. Glenn Myer of your Region 1 office has notified us of NRC concerns regarding our actions taken to prevent recurrence of the subject violation.
1 In the Notice of Violation, it was noted that we had issued a Ictter which authorized NUS Corporation to make minor "non-intent" revisions to the Station
~
Met.corological Monitoring System calibration procedure. This permission to change procedurco without. Onsite Safety Committee review and the approval of the Station Superintendent is contrary to our Technical Specifications. Our l
" action taken to prevent recurrence" stated that a meeting was held between i
Duquesne Light. and NUS where it was agreed that the procedure would be controlled I
within the Station's MSP program and that any change what-so-ever to the pro-j cedure would require station review and approval.
In addition, a statement will be added to the beginning of the Meteorologic.il Monitoring System calibration
{-
procedure denoting that changea can only be made with proper Station review and approval.
Our meeting discurisions with NUS should preclude future problems with NUS-performed procedures.
i We have conducted a review of all other vendors who perform maintenance activit.ies at the Station and we have determined that no similar authorizations have 'seen given to these vendora to change their procedures. We consider the NUS situation to be unique in that the procedure is performed offsite by the vendor wititout station support. Controls currently provided by the Station i
Administrative Procedures are considered to be adequate for other vendor procedures.
